The " Index of Saheb Biwi Aur Gangster " refers to the acclaimed Indian crime thriller film franchise directed by Tigmanshu Dhulia. The series is known for its intense drama, palace intrigue, and themes of betrayal and lust. 🎬 Film Series Index Saheb, Biwi Aur Gangster (2011)
: The first installment introduces Raja Aditya Pratap Singh (Saheb), his wife Chhoti Rani (Biwi), and a hired assassin (Gangster). It explores the dangerous power struggle within their royal household. Saheb, Biwi Aur Gangster Returns (2013)
: The sequel follows Aditya as he deals with betrayal and a new rival prince seeking revenge for his family's lost property. Saheb, Biwi Aur Gangster 3 (2018)
: The third film features Sanjay Dutt as the new antagonist. It centers on Aditya returning from prison to reclaim his political legacy amidst ongoing palace conspiracies. Exploring the "index" or structure of work surrounding the Saheb Biwi Aur Gangster
film series involves examining its origins, character dynamics, and its evolution across a trilogy directed by Tigmanshu Dhulia. The series is fundamentally a modern, "gritty" homage to the 1962 classic Sahib Bibi Aur Ghulam
, relocating its themes of feudal decadence to the power-hungry politics of modern-day Uttar Pradesh. Core Structural Framework
The series is indexed by three primary character archetypes, whose shifting power dynamics drive each installment: The Saheb (Aditya Pratap Singh):
An erstwhile royal struggling to maintain ancestral status amidst crumbling wealth and modern democratic politics. He represents ego, pride, and the desperate lengths a man will go to for power. The Biwi (Madhavi Devi):
Originally a neglected, unfulfilled wife yearning for attention, she evolves into a formidable and often volatile player. By the sequel, she becomes an MLA, using her position and "seductress ways" to manipulate those around her. The Gangster: The dynamic between Saheb, Biwi, and Gangster serves
This role serves as the catalyst for conflict in each film, often motivated by unrequited love or a desire for respect. Part 1 (Babloo):
An ambitious young man who enters the royal household and becomes entangled in the Raani’s yearning for attention. Part 2 (Indrajeet Singh):
A ragged prince seeking to restore family honor destroyed by the Saheb’s ancestors. Part 3 (Kabir/Baba):
A sophisticated outlaw with a "heart and a temper" who challenges the established order. Key Themes of the Work

The term "index of" is a specialized search query used to find open directory listings on web servers—essentially, public folders where files (like movies, music, or software) are stored without privacy protection.
